        "content": "<p>Ulemas ask for Rp 5.1b aid, council objects<\/p>\n<p>Ahmad Junaidi, The Jakarta Post, Jakarta<\/p>\n<p>City councillors objected on Thursday to a request by the Jakarta<br>\nUlemas Council (MUI DKI) that it be allocated Rp 5.1 billion in<br>\naid by the administration.<\/p>\n<p>&quot;The planned use of the fund has very little to do with public<br>\ninterest. Most of the aid would be used for its administrative<br>\nand organizational affairs,&quot; said the chairman of City Council<br>\nCommission E for people&apos;s welfare, Nadjamuddin.<\/p>\n<p>According to MUI&apos;s written request for aid signed by MUI<br>\nchairman Mursyidi and secretary Zainuddin, some of the money<br>\nwould be used to finance a comparative study in Singapore and<br>\nMalaysia.<\/p>\n<p>Members of the commission also objected to MUI&apos;s request.<\/p>\n<p>&quot;It&apos;s too much. What if other religious organizations ask for<br>\nthe same amount? We could not afford it,&quot; said Supangat of the<br>\nIndonesian Democratic Party of Struggle.<\/p>\n<p>Supangat suggested that the MUI approach the Ministry of<br>\nReligious Affairs for a donation because just like defense,<br>\nfinance and foreign affairs, religious affairs is handled by the<br>\ncentral government in accordance with regional autonomy.<\/p>\n<p>MUI&apos;s plan to send its members on a comparative study abroad<br>\nto visit Muslim councils and courts may have been inspired by<br>\ncity councillors.<\/p>\n<p>Last year, councillors visited Bangkok, Beijing, Morocco and<br>\nSpain at the expense of city agencies.<\/p>\n<p>In the 2002 budget, funds for foreign trips were eliminated<br>\nafter the trips were criticized as a waste of time by the public.<\/p>\n<p>The City Council will discuss the 2003 draft budget, totaling<br>\nRp 11 trillion, in the middle of this month.<\/p>\n<p>The budget, which is scheduled to be approved by the end of<br>\nthis month, allocates funds for projects and routine expenditure,<br>\nincluding donations for social and religious organizations.<\/p>\n<p>MUI DKI secretary Zainuddin confirmed that his organization<br>\nhad requested the money, saying the funds would also be used to<br>\nimprove public behavior.<\/p>\n<p>MUI&apos;s written request stated that the Rp 5.1 billion would<br>\nalso be used to buy computers and a camera, and to finance its<br>\nfatwa commission.<\/p>\n<p>MUI and its commission have recently been criticized for their<br>\nrulings.<\/p>\n<p>The chairman of MUI Bandung, Athian Ali, recently issued a<br>\nfatwa saying that scholar Ulil Abshar Abdala deserved the death<br>\npenalty for his newspaper article on Islamic reform.<\/p>\n<p>The Balikpapan, East Kalimantan, MUI office reportedly issued<br>\na fatwa stating that blowing a paper trumpet on New Year&apos;s Eve<br>\nwas haram (forbidden).<\/p>\n<p>Two years ago, MUI banned a song titled Takdir (Destiny) by<br>\nlocal singer Dessy Ratnasari.<\/p>\n<p>Former president Abdurrahman Wahid once suggested dissolving<br>\nMUI and the Ministry of Religious Affairs because of the number<br>\nof outlandish fatwa they had issued.<\/p>",
